Why Printed Albums Matter More Than Ever

Printed albums offer a level of permanence digital files simply cannot match. Professional archival printing techniques use acid-free papers and pigment-based inks designed specifically to resist fading, yellowing, or image decay over decades. This commitment to photo preservation ensures your wedding memories remain vibrant and clear for generations.

High-Quality Materials Elevate the Album Experience

Durability matters because an album is meant to be more than a keepsake—it’s a lasting legacy. Unlike digital files vulnerable to accidental deletion, corrupted drives, or obsolete formats, printed albums hold strong through time and use. They become treasured family heirlooms you can physically pass down, ensuring your story remains accessible and cherished by future generations.

Here are some ways how high-quality materials elevate the album experience beyond mere storage:

  • Lay-flat pages allow seamless panoramic spreads without image distortion or gutter loss.
  • Luxurious covers crafted from fine leather, linen, or velvet provide tactile elegance and protect the interior.
  • Thick, durable paper stocks withstand frequent handling without tearing or warping.

Displaying Heirloom Artwork in the Home: Framing Options and Keepsake Boxes

Heirloom artwork deserves to be showcased with care and style, making it a living part of your home’s atmosphere. You have multiple framing options to consider:

1. Classic Framed Prints

Choose frames that complement your interior design, such as sleek black for modern spaces or ornate wood for traditional rooms. Using UV-blocking glass protects the image while enhancing its clarity.

2. Gallery Walls

Combine several heirloom photos in coordinated frames to create a striking visual story, perfect for hallways or living rooms.

3. Floating Frames

These add depth and a contemporary feel by suspending the print between glass panes.

Displaying printed albums on coffee tables invites guests to explore your memories casually. A well-chosen album cover material—linen, leather, or velvet—can harmonize with your furniture textures.

Keepsake boxes offer an elegant way to store additional prints safely. They can be personalized and designed to match your décor style, whether rustic wood for farmhouse charm or sleek acrylic for minimalist interiors.

Tips on Blending Heirloom Artwork with Home Décor Styles

  • Coordinate frame colors with existing accents like cushions or rugs.
  • Match album materials with upholstery fabrics for cohesiveness.
  • Position artwork at eye level in well-lit areas to maximize impact.
  • Use neutral tones in frames and albums to ensure timelessness amid changing décor trends.

Proper Care to Preserve Heirloom Albums for Future Generations

To ensure the longevity of your heirloom albums, it's crucial to implement best practices that protect printed artwork from environmental damage. One effective method is using UV-blocking glass or acrylic in frames, which provides essential UV protection against harmful sunlight.

Additionally, maintaining proper temperature control is vital. Extreme heat or humidity can cause significant damage to your albums. Therefore, storing these precious items in a cool, dry place will help preserve their quality.

Printed Albums as an Investment Beyond Digital Storage Solutions

While [digital storage offers convenience](<https: data-preserve-html-node="true"//mdkauffmann.com/st-louis-wedding-photographer/category/Digital+Photography>), it falls short when it comes to preserving emotional value and tangible memories. Files can be lost, corrupted, or forgotten on a hard drive, phone, or cloud service. Printed albums provide a physical keepsake that you can hold, share, and pass down through generations.

Key advantages of printed albums compared to digital-only storage include:

  • Longevity: Professionally printed albums use archival-quality paper and inks designed to resist fading and deterioration over decades.
  • Tactile Experience: The texture of pages and weight of the album engage multiple senses, creating a deeper emotional connection than viewing images on a screen.
  • Accessibility: Albums are instantly accessible without technical barriers or concerns about obsolete file formats and devices.
  • Family Heirlooms: A well-crafted album becomes a treasured family artifact, sparking stories and memories during gatherings.
